Layout and Structure
Open Plan
An open-plan living room is characterized by a lack of walls, creating a sense of spaciousness. You can describe this as:
- “An open-plan living room fosters a sense of openness and flow.”
- “The living room boasts an open layout, which makes the space feel larger and more connected.”
Separate Zones
If you have separate zones within the living room, such as a seating area, a dining nook, or a home office, you might say:
- “The living room is divided into distinct zones, each with its own purpose.”
- “The room is cleverly segmented into a cozy seating area, a dining corner, and a quiet work space.”
Color Scheme
Neutral Base
A neutral color palette can create a calming and versatile foundation for your living room. You can describe this as:
- “The living room is anchored by a soothing neutral color scheme.”
- “A monochromatic color palette provides a tranquil backdrop for the room.”
Accents
To add warmth and personality, you can introduce color accents through:
- “Striking color accents bring vibrancy to the neutral backdrop.”
- “The space is enlivened with pops of color in the form of artwork and throw pillows.”
Furniture
Seating Arrangement
The seating in a living room should be comfortable and encourage conversation. You might describe it as:
- “The seating arrangement is designed to promote comfortable conversation and relaxation.”
- “The living room features a plush sofa and armchairs, arranged to create a cozy conversational nook.”
Coffee Table
A coffee table can serve as a focal point and a practical surface. You can describe it as:
- “The sleek coffee table provides a stylish and functional surface for drinks and snacks.”
- “The coffee table is a sleek piece that complements the modern aesthetic of the room.”
Decor and Accessories
Artwork
Artwork can add character and a touch of personal style. You can describe it as:
- “The living room is adorned with thought-provoking artwork that complements the room’s color scheme.”
- “The walls are adorned with a collection of framed prints and photographs that tell a story of the homeowner’s travels.”
Lighting
Lighting is crucial for setting the mood and creating ambiance. You might say:
- “The living room is illuminated by a mix of natural light and soft, ambient lighting.”
- “The room benefits from a blend of overhead lighting, floor lamps, and wall sconces, offering flexibility in lighting options.”
